Name | 4-(chloromethyl)biphenyl |
Synonyms | 4CMB 4-cmb 4-Chloromethylbiphen p-phenylbenzylchloride 4-Chloromethylbiphenyl p-phenylbenzyl chloride 4-Chloromethyl Biphenyl p-Phenylbenzyl Chloride 4-(chloromethyl)-bipheny 4-(chloromethyl)biphenyl 4-BIPHENYLMETHYL CHLORIDE |
CAS | 1667-11-4 |
EINECS | 216-786-5 |
InChI | InChI=1/C13H11Cl/c14-10-11-6-8-13(9-7-11)12-4-2-1-3-5-12/h1-9H,10H2 |
Molecular Formula | C13H11Cl |
Molar Mass | 202.68 |
Density | 1.1339 (estimate) |
Melting Point | 70-73 °C (lit.) |
Boling Point | 321.03°C (rough estimate) |
Flash Point | 143.2°C |
Vapor Presure | 0.000527mmHg at 25°C |
BRN | 1863327 |
Storage Condition | 2-8℃ |
Refractive Index | 1.5945 (estimate) |
MDL | MFCD00000917 |
Physical and Chemical Properties | Appearance white to off-white crystalline powder Content (HPLC) ≥ 95% |
